TORONTO, ONTARIO -- (Marketwire) -- 01/14/13 -- Kilo Goldmines Ltd. ("Kilo" or the "Company") (TSX VENTURE: KGL)(FRANKFURT: 02K) is pleased to announce significant results from six additional diamond drill holes, totalling 1,292.50 m. These results include 4.07 m grading 17.25 g/t Au commencing at a downhole depth of 126.8 m, including 1.07 m grading 63.8 g/t Au in hole SMDD0018.
Other Highlights Include
-- 9.55 m @ 2.72 g/t Au-- 2.00 m @ 23.46 g/t Au-- 700 m strike continuous gold zone-- gold zone part of open-ended 2.2 km gold bearing structure
These additional holes, at approximately 160 m intervals, as illustrated on Figure 1, now define a strike length of 700 m at the Manzako Prospect, which is on the Company's Somituri Project in northeastern Democratice Republic of Congo ("DRC"). The Manzako structure is estimated to be 2.2km in strike length as defined by colonial-era mining, previous trenches, soil sampling results and geological mapping. The Manzako Prospect is 5.0 km east and south from, and parallel to, the Company's 1.87 M oz Adumbi gold deposit.
The gold intersections obtained in the Kilo drill holes, presented from southeast to northwest, are listed in Table 1 and the drill holes are illustrated on Figure 1. The location of the Manzako Prospect with respect to other Prospects on the Imbo licence is illustrated in Figure 2.
